At just 35 Viktor Orban, then a fiery radical, became Europe's youngest prime minister. Since then, his political brand has undergone an astonishing change.
So how did the student dissident become a 21st Century demagogue?
Guests:
Zsuzsanna Szelenyi - Program director at the CEU Democracy Institute, former Hungarian politician and author, Tainted Democracy Viktor Orban and the Subversion of Hungary
Nick Thorpe - The BBC's Central Europe correspondent
Ben Wellings - Associate Professor of politics and international relations at Monash University
